Web5 de abr. de 2024 · In research, honey bees have been observed to fly anywhere between 1 – 6 km (with a mean of 5.5 km)1 but also up to 13.5 km2 . (I have seen it stated that 20 km has also been recorded, but have not located the research paper to check this finding). In general, it is believed honey bees are generally not ‘doorstep’ foragers.

WebThe dark-edged bee-fly, or 'Large bee-fly', looks rather like a bumblebee, with a long, straight proboscis that it uses to feed on nectar from spring flowers, such as primroses and violets.
